What Is a Turnkey Package?
"Turnkey" describes something built, supplied, or installed complete and ready to operate. Merriam-Webster traces the adjective back to 1860, and the meaning hasn't shifted much since: the buyer takes possession of something finished, not something they need to assemble.
The term's origin is literal. In a turnkey arrangement, the buyer simply turns a key to start operations instead of building the thing themselves. In legal and business use, a turnkey contract means the contractor holds full responsibility for planning and building the project, with the client using it immediately once it's complete.
Applied to packaging machinery, a turnkey package means the supplier handles line design, equipment selection, integration, and commissioning. You don't hire a separate engineer to make everything work together. Production starts once the line lands on your floor.
Defining Characteristics of a Turnkey Arrangement
A genuine turnkey setup typically includes:
- One point of contact for the entire project, not five vendors pointing fingers at each other
- A defined scope and price, agreed before work begins
- Complete design accountability resting with the supplier, not split across departments
- Ready-to-run delivery, meaning the line works when it arrives, not after weeks of troubleshooting
Compare that to buying machines individually. You order a filler from one company, a capper from another, and a labeler from a third. Nobody owns the whole picture.
If the filler and capper don't talk to each other on the conveyor, you're stuck mediating between two vendors who each blame the other's equipment. That's the "weak link" risk of piecemeal purchasing: no single party accountable for the finished line's performance.
Turnkey vs. Full Turnkey: What's the Difference?
Here's something worth knowing before you get too attached to the terminology: "full turnkey" isn't a standardized industry category. No dictionary, trade association, or regulatory body defines it as a formal tier separate from "turnkey."
In practice, though, suppliers use the terms differently. Standard turnkey generally covers design, supply, and installation up through a ready-to-operate handover, while "full turnkey" (as some suppliers use it) often stretches further, adding extended warranties, spare parts stocking, remote monitoring, or ongoing performance support.
Because there's no universal definition, the label alone tells you very little. Ask any machinery supplier for a detailed scope-of-work document. That's the only way to know exactly where their turnkey coverage ends and where extra costs begin.

What Does a Turnkey Packaging Package Include?
A real turnkey packaging package goes well beyond dropping machines at your door. Here's what should be on the table.
Equipment Selection, Line Design, and Installation
The supplier matches machinery to your product, not the other way around. That means selecting fillers, cappers, labelers, bottling equipment, VFFS units, or multihead weighers based on:
- Fill volume and product viscosity
- Container type and material
- Required throughput
Line design and layout engineering follow, covering conveyor integration, facility footprint planning, and workflow sequencing so the equipment fits your existing plant, not a hypothetical one.
Once equipment is selected, installation and commissioning bring it into your existing plant systems, including PLCs, HMIs, and upstream or downstream machinery already on your floor. Before handover, the line should run through testing and validation, confirming speed, fill accuracy, and weight verification.
This matters even more in regulated industries. Food, pharmaceutical, and chemical manufacturers face documented equipment and validation requirements tied to their packaging lines. A supplier who understands this builds it into the process rather than treating it as an afterthought.
Training, Documentation, and Ongoing Support
Your team needs to run the equipment without calling the supplier every week. That means:
- Operator training on day-to-day use
- Manuals and maintenance schedules for upkeep
- Access to technical support after installation

Example of a Turnkey Packaging Line in Action
Picture a beverage manufacturer launching a new bottled product. The supplier assesses the product's viscosity and the container's shape, then selects a filler sized to the fill volume, a capper matched to the closure type, and a labeler suited to the container's surface.
A check weigher and metal detector get integrated for quality control before the line ships. Everything arrives pre-tested and ready to run.
Packaging World's coverage of turnkey line integration describes this exact approach: the whole line gets tested together before delivery, rather than each machine being debugged separately on the customer's plant floor.
Compare that to sourcing five machines from five vendors. You'd be the one troubleshooting why the capper jams every third bottle because the timing doesn't match the filler's output. Benefits of a Turnkey Packaging Solution for Manufacturers
The advantages of going turnkey show up long before you flip the switch on a new line.
Single point of accountability. One supplier manages design, delivery, and support. If something underperforms, there's no ambiguity about who fixes it.
Packaging World's integration research notes this consolidation also cuts internal staff time spent coordinating multiple vendors and reduces the number of trips needed to get a line running.
Faster time-to-production. Because equipment arrives pre-integrated and pre-tested, on-site commissioning delays shrink considerably. You're not waiting weeks for machines to "learn" how to work together.
Lower compatibility risk. The supplier bears responsibility for the entire line's performance, not just one machine's specs on paper. That shifts risk away from your team.
Improved ROI through precision. Accurate fill and weight verification directly reduce product giveaway. Manufacturers using checkweighing and multihead weighing technology catch underfills and overfills before products leave the plant, protecting margins on every unit shipped.
Simplified compliance support. Food, pharmaceutical, and chemical products carry different but overlapping regulatory demands, from equipment calibration checks to labeling accuracy. Experienced turnkey suppliers build these considerations into equipment selection from the start, rather than leaving compliance as your problem to solve after installation.
Is a Turnkey Package Right for Your Facility?
Turnkey solutions make the most sense for manufacturers who are:
- Launching a new product line and need equipment matched to it from scratch
- Scaling production beyond what current machinery can handle
- Replacing outdated equipment without an in-house engineering team to manage integration
Before committing, walk through a few key considerations:
- Budget flexibility: what tradeoffs are acceptable between automation level and upfront cost?
- Facility space: does your floor plan accommodate the line layout being proposed?
- Product characteristics: do viscosity, container type, and fill range match the equipment you're considering?
- Automation level: how much manual handling are you trying to eliminate?

Frequently Asked Questions
What does a turnkey package include?
A turnkey packaging package typically covers equipment selection, installation, integration with existing systems, testing and validation, and operator training. The goal is a line ready to run without additional engineering work on your end.
What is an example of a turnkey package?
A complete bottling line, delivered pre-integrated and pre-tested, is a common example. The supplier selects and combines the filler, capper, labeler, and quality control equipment into one validated system before it ships.
What is the difference between turnkey and full turnkey?
Turnkey generally covers design through installation and handover. "Full turnkey," where suppliers use the term, often adds ongoing support, spare parts stocking, or performance guarantees, though this isn't a standardized definition across the industry.
How much does a turnkey packaging package cost?
Cost depends on equipment complexity, integration scope, and industry compliance needs. Because every line is different, requesting a custom quote from your supplier is the only reliable way to get accurate pricing.
How long does it take to implement a turnkey packaging line?
Timelines range from several weeks to a few months, depending on equipment complexity, customization requirements, and how ready your facility is for installation. Simpler lines move faster than highly customized, multi-machine systems.
Can a turnkey package be customized for my specific product?
Yes. Suppliers tailor turnkey designs around your specific product characteristics, container type, and throughput needs rather than offering one-size-fits-all configurations. This customization is what makes the line work for your operation immediately after installation.
